Output 2101325dc9bba8bf96f964dfdb4a51ead2665149b44aa4ba2967243b6d9752d5:1

value
68569748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20df3d5ee1e95b66c60a5e0a49b543d2bdaa82c OP_EQUAL
address
3PktAQHNMLrjr59JnfLpdqPh2TDhuARbqZ
transaction
2101325dc9bba8bf96f964dfdb4a51ead2665149b44aa4ba2967243b6d9752d5
spent
true